Preparing to leave: Some of the 38 troopships ships that assembled in King George Sound off Albany, Western Australia, in October 1914
Preparing to leave: Some of the 38 troopships ships that assembled in King George Sound off Albany, Western Australia, in October 1914

The first Australian and New Zealand Army Corps convoy steamed out of King George Sound on the morning of November 1, 1914.
